Cook sausages first. Remove from saucepan. Fry off onions, carrots and any other veg you have and may like to add (courgettes, red peppers, leeks, cauliflower, broccoli are all good). Add tin of chopped tomatoes, some herbs (herbes de provence are good, otherwise parsley and oregano are my faves) and a couple of handfuls of red split lentils. Add some Worcestershire sauce. Add the sausages back in.
Add enough water or vegetable stock to cover everything. Bring to the boil, then lower heat, cover and simmer until the lentils and veg are cooked. Stir occasionally.
It's also nice if you add some chard or spinach near the end of cooking.
